Contrasting lines that are horizontal and vertical create what kind of angle?

Explanation:
When horizontal and vertical lines intersect, they form a specific type of angle that is foundational in geometry and various design applications. The intersection of these two types of lines creates a right angle, which measures exactly 90 degrees. This characteristic is essential in haircutting and styling as it helps in achieving precise and balanced designs. Understanding the significance of this right angle is crucial for stylists and barbers, especially when creating shapes and sections in haircuts. Right angles help in establishing structure, such as when layering or creating geometric styles that require sharp, well-defined corners. By mastering the creation and manipulation of 90-degree angles, professionals can ensure they maintain symmetry and proportion in their hairstyles.
